Recognizing the Duty of a Registered Agent
A company registered agent, also known as a statutory agent or resident representative, functions as the official factor of get in touch with in between the organization and state authorities. This individual or entity is responsible for receiving legal files, such as service of procedure, tax obligation notifications, and official government document in behalf of the company. Having actually a registered agent is a legal requirement in many states for Firms and llcs, guaranteeing that there is a reputable means for authorities to connect with the organization. The registered agent should preserve a physical street address within the state of consolidation or development, and be offered throughout normal organization hours to accept files.
